A mineral is a naturally occurring solid inorganic substance with a definite chemical composition. Minerals are typically formed through various geological processes and can be found in different environments on Earth. They can range in composition from simple elements to complex compounds.

Antacids typically contain inorganic compounds such as calcium carbonate, magnesium hydroxide, or aluminum hydroxide. These compounds work by neutralizing stomach acid to provide relief from heartburn and indigestion.
